D

e Beers Venetia Mine introduced the EOI (Expression of Interest) process in 2017 to drive the inclusion of local suppliers into the main procurement activities of the mine. The EOI allows for local procurement opportunities in the Musina and Blouberg areas. SMEs that meet the requirements are shortlisted and participate in the tender processes. Since the inception of the programme Venetia Mine has appointed 31 local black-owned SMEs as suppliers, employing more than 200 local people. They are enrolled on the Venetia Mine Supplier Development Programme. The two-year programme includes formal mentorship and training in areas such us Human Resources, Financial Management and Pricing and Costing. These local business initiatives target local, HDSA youth, women and disabled-owned entities to ensure a lasting impact where it is needed most. A company like Ikefree Projects (Pty) Ltd is a black youth-owned company responsible for building maintenance on the mine. Ravujhani Construction and Projects (Pty) Ltd and Amezdo Trading and Projects are black women-owned construction companies. The local procurement transformation aims to LIMPOPO BUSINESS 2018/19

assist SMEs to expand beyond the borders of Venetia Mine and become mainstream businesses supporting the socio-economic activities of the local areas. More recently, the bussing empowerment deal with VM Diamond Transport was concluded. A partnership with Africa’s Auction Authority, Aucor, led to the establishment of Aucor Limpopo, which will see 51% of the business owned by a local business from Blouberg. The aim of this venture is to grow the skills and scope of the local partners, teaching them about the intricacies of the auction industry. These are major milestones for De Beers and the Limpopo region. Both empowerment deals are in line with the continuous drive to uplift communities.
